I had some trouble with the Messaging Plugins, therefore had to turn to the doctor. First of all, I copied the PalmDatabase.db3 to my PC, and then did a complete wipe with doctoring and so on. Having tried getting my SMS and contacts data back in 5 different orders (all including the wipe doctor), I have come now to the conclusion that the trouble is caused by the PalmDatabase.db3. See why: I doctored my pre, and before doing anything else I installed the Messaging Plugins (in the order greg recommends, of course). Each step followed by a reboot, just to go sure. Having done that, I could choose out of all 12 messaging services when trying to add a new messaging account. Then I copied my stored PalmDatabase.db3 back to the Palm and did another restart. Nothing else. Now, all of a sudden I only can choose out of 9 services. Yahoo, Live Messenger and Jabber have disappeared. This makes me think that my PalmDatabase.db3 is defective. What do you think? Any suggestions? Most of all, I don't want to loose my contact's history (e.g. SMS). HELP!

Just to let you know, I could step a bit further:
After I put my PalmDatabase.db3 onto the device, my two messaging accounts appeared in the messaging application's settings. I deleted them, deleted greg's plugins (in revers order to installation), and installed them again. As mentioned before, doing a reboot after each step. Well, now everything seems fine, except some issues connecting to Google Talk. Unfortunately, I lost all my messenger contacts' history. When there's an update available (webOS or greg's plugins), do I always have to delete my messenger accounts? Seems like doing so always causes a loss of the history. Any ideas how to keep them? Or how to extract them out of my backupped PalmDatabase.db3? Well, actually I can read the contents with the firefox plugin "SQLite Manager". But I have no clue how to really "manage" them, regarding the there-might-be-any-dependecies-nobody-is-aware-of db structure. |

Just solved my problem withe Facebook accounts showing up as numbers instead of names: Switched “Enable Avatars” to false. Now all names are showing up. Maybe this simple fix will work for others?

Even though pidgin and libpurple (what this is all based off) supports a skype plugin it requires skype to be installed on the computer/phone. As such this wont work. ![]() Greg |

Not sure if this has been mentioned before but if you link a profile (synergy) with the facebook contact id.. it will display the linked profile name in the messenger. I had to do some cross referencing in facebook to find out what friend had what ID# but.. I only have a handful of friends I talk to on FB. I know this would be impossible for some but perhaps.. you can add some of your more important contacts using this method.
